According to the PREMIERE article, most of the cast and crew in the film were seasick while making it, to the point of barfing between lines, not just takes! My point being that if you plan to see this film, for your own benefit, TAKE A DRAMAMINE PILL before going to the theater. One pill lasts up to 4 hours, so you can take it well before you go, to give it time to get into your system.
This may keep you from missing the action due to nausea, etc.!! And I wouldn't plan on eating any popcorn either, unless you have a strong stomach.
